Frequently Asked Questions
What is the ICD-10 code for other polycystic kidney, infantile type?

The ICD-10-CM code for other polycystic kidney, infantile type is Q61.19. The full clinical description is "Other polycystic kidney, infantile type". Q61.19 is a billable/specific code that can be used on insurance claims and medical billing.

What does ICD-10 code Q61.19 mean?

ICD-10-CM code Q61.19 represents “Other polycystic kidney, infantile type”. It is classified under Chapter 17: Congenital Malformations, Deformations and Chromosomal Abnormalities and is a billable/specific code that can be used on a claim.

Is Q61.19 a billable code?

Yes, Q61.19 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code and can be used to indicate a diagnosis on a medical claim.

What chapter is Q61.19 in?

Q61.19 is in Chapter 17: Congenital Malformations, Deformations and Chromosomal Abnormalities (codes Q00-Q99).

What codes cannot be used with Q61.19?

Q61.19 has Excludes1 notes indicating codes that cannot be used together with it, including: acquired cyst of kidney (N28.1); Potter's syndrome (Q60.6).

What SNOMED CT codes does Q61.19 map to?

Q61.19 maps to 1 SNOMED CT concept: 28770003. SNOMED CT is a clinical terminology used in electronic health records.

What are the UMLS CUIs for Q61.19?

Q61.19 is linked to 1 UMLS Concept Unique Identifier: C2910225. The UMLS (Unified Medical Language System) integrates multiple biomedical vocabularies maintained by the U.S. National Library of Medicine.
